Position Overview :
This position provides Process Instrumentation maintenance support within Indy Pharmaceutical Manufacturing. This position will focus on equipment uptime, calibration, and reliability. The applicant will work closely with Production, Engineering, Quality Control, Labs, and various other groups to troubleshoot, maintain, and perform Corrective and Preventative maintenance on Process Instrumentation and provide project support on production and utility related equipment.
Key Objectives / Deliverables :
- Demonstrate a good process aptitude and application of skills in a variety of real-world process experiences (e.g., transmitters ranging from pressure, temperature, flow, PH, and level).
- Install / replace basic electrical equipment (e.g., switches, fuses, cables, circuit breakers, light fixtures, raceways, conduit, disconnects, temporary power) including sizing if necessary.
- Install / set-up / replace Instrument / electrical equipment (e.g., switches, transmitters, controllers, VFDs, various types of process instrumentation).
- Effectively diagnose basic electrical problems, to effect repairs and restore equipment / systems to operating condition (e.g., lighting circuits, 3-wire control circuits, 12 / 24V control circuits, 120V circuitry, heat tracing, motor resets, fuse changes, breaker resets, etc.).
- Effectively diagnose and troubleshoot complex electrical equipment from 24 VDC to 480 VAC to restore equipment / systems to operating condition.
- Operate basic electrical / pneumatic test equipment (e.g., flukes, signal generators, oscilloscopes, Amtek, MKS).
- Provide Process Instrumentation support for equipment qualification (IQ / OQ).
- Provide accurate, complete, and legible Work Order documentation on both paper copy (when required) and in CMMS work order system (GMARS).
